Leben des Galilei
- By: Bertolt Brecht
- Narrated by: Andreas Schulze, Stefan Lisewski, Peter Aust, and others
- Length: 2 hrs and 39 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Die Erde steht nicht im Mittelpunkt des Universums. Diese aufsehenerregende These kann der geniale Physiker und Naturforscher Galileo Galilei im Italien des 17. Jahrhunderts mit der Erfindung eines neuen Fernrohrs beweisen und zieht damit den Zorn der Kirche auf sich. Diese befürchtet mit der Abwendung vom ptolemäischen Weltbild einen gesellschaftlichen Umsturz. Verfolgt von der Inquisition und aus Angst vor Folter verleugnet Galilei schließlich seine Entdeckung. Als alter Mann kann er sich diesen Verrat an seiner Überzeugung nicht verzeihen und lässt eine Schrift über seine Entdeckung außer Landes schmuggeln.

Die wertvolle Medizin des Waldes
- Wie die Natur Körper und Geist stärkt
- By: Qing Li
- Narrated by: Andreas Neumann
- Length: 3 hrs and 3 mins
- Abrid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Jeder von uns weiß, wie gut ein Spaziergang im Wald tun kann. Aber warum ist das so? Der japanische Forstwissenschaftler und Mediziner Dr. Qing Li hat über 30 Jahre lang die heilsame Kraft des Waldes erforscht und die mittlerweile weltweit beliebte Methode des Shinrin Yoku entwickelt. Ihre Wirksamkeit ist unumstritten: Stress wird reduziert, Herz-Kreislauf-System und Stoffwechsel verbessert, der Blutzucker gesenkt, Depressionen gemildert und das Immunsystem gestärkt. Das Waldbaden bietet so die Möglichkeit, unsere Beziehung zur Natur zu erneuern und Kraft aus ihr zu schöpfen.
